How they compare
China, mainland currently reports 294,460 kt against 20,190 kt in Viet Nam, a difference of 274,270 kt.
That makes China, mainland's figure about 14.6 times Viet Nam's.
Across all 63 years both countries report, China, mainland has been ahead every year.
China, mainland ranks 3rd and Viet Nam ranks 6th of 226 countries.
China, mainland has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| China, mainland | Viet Nam |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 74,504 kt | 3,795 kt | 70,709 kt | China, mainland |
| 1970s | 113,392 kt | 4,512 kt | 108,880 kt | China, mainland |
| 1980s | 179,447 kt | 6,254 kt | 173,193 kt | China, mainland |
| 1990s | 253,201 kt | 11,007 kt | 242,193 kt | China, mainland |
| 2000s | 289,957 kt | 15,175 kt | 274,781 kt | China, mainland |
| 2010s | 310,397 kt | 17,547 kt | 292,850 kt | China, mainland |
| 2020s | 293,408 kt | 19,515 kt | 273,894 kt | China, mainland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
